The New York State Department of Transportation is currently engaged in a highly controversial effort to expand the NY Route 33 Kensington Expressway. Among the advocates opposing this initiative is the East Side Collaborative Partnership, an environmental activism group founded by HG's CEO, Sherry Sherrill. ESCP is part of a broader network of partners involved in the Highway Removal Movement currently underway around the global community, and which has now reached Buffalo, New York. Supporting this development are various groups, including the East Side Parkways Coalition, We Are Women Warriors, Covington Associates Consulting, Partnership For The Public Good, WNY Youth Climate Council, Citizens For Regional Transit, ESCP [East Side Collab], East Side Stewards, Voice Buffalo, Coalition For Economic Justice, and too, East Side Stewards. At Covington Associates Consulting, Ms. Sherrill has played a pivotal role in the nomination and inclusion of the NY Route 33 Kensington and the NY Route 198 Scajaquada expressways, in the 2025 edition of Congress For The New Urbanism's influential report: "Freeways Without Futures".
